Assuming which the reader can notify what’s a website link and what isn’t, you don’t have to tell her to click it. The net has been A part of our professional life for 20 yrs now. Even the grumpiest outdated technophobe inside your organization understands what to try and do with a url.
The primary reason I take advantage of descriptive inbound links is to boost accessibility. Such as, display screen readers for the visually impaired can be made to read out only the links on the page.

In lieu of saying “click here,” it’s almost certainly improved for making concrete and suitable nouns within a sentence the link anchors. Concrete nouns are very best in my opinion since they are more immediate and vidid and provides buyers a much better concept of what they will get after they click via. Proper nouns are great because they represent exceptional entities that jump out in and of by themselves.
